Big HOTAS Patch!
Hey all,
This patch focuses entirely on HOTAS selection and customization system.
- Increase device detection limit from 4 to 14. Now if you have a whole bunch of devices connected they'll list them out. Keep in mind you'll want to choose your PRIMARY input device for controlling the aircraft. If you have a stick, throttle, pedals, etc you'll want to choose the stick.
- Customization now fully works including saving profiles and resetting back to defaults.
We think we caught most, if not all, the bugs but as always if you encounter something wonky please drop us an email at support@bitplanetgames.com.
